HondaCars India Ltd. (HCIL), recorded its highest ever monthly sales with 15714 units in January 2014 registering a growth of 188pc, riding on the success of the newly launched all new Honda City. The company sold 5451 units in the corresponding month last year
The Jan’14 sales result reflects a strong growth over the past few months attributed to the enormous consumer response to the Honda Amaze and the all new Honda City. Model wise break up were Brio 1015 unithttp://www.motownindia.com/Motown/Admin/Edit_News.aspx?id=966s, Amaze 7398 units, City 7184 units, CRV 117 units. The company exported a total of 88 vehicles in the month.
Expressing delight on the company’s performance Jnaneswar Sen, Sr. Vice President – Marketing &Sales, Honda Cars India Ltd. said, “We have started the year on a positive note. We have received an overwhelming response to all new Honda City and the Honda Amaze continues to do strong sales. We would like to thank our customers for their constant support in achieving our highest ever monthly sales.”
HCIL also exported a total volume of 88 units during January 2014.
The company also achieved the milestone of crossing 1 lac units sales for the first time during the current financial year. It sold 101370 units in Apr’13– Jan 14 period registering a growth of78pc .The company’s sales for the corresponding period last year was at 56929 units.
